Why Consider a Cat Flap?

Before diving into the details of cat flap installation, let's discuss the benefits:

  1. Freedom: Cats can explore their environment without relying on human help.
  2. Workout: Outdoor access encourages exercise, which is crucial for preserving a healthy weight.
  3. Less Stress: A cat flap can relieve the stress and anxiety that some cats feel when they wish to head out but can not.
  4. No More Scratching: By permitting your cat to exit and enter freely, you can reduce the possibilities of them scratching at doors.

Choosing the Right Installer

When it pertains to employing a cat flap installer, consider the following:

  1. Experience: Look for someone who focuses on pet door installations.
  2. Reviews: Check online reviews and reviews from previous clients to evaluate their dependability.
  3. Quotation: Always demand a quote before continuing. This can help avoid unforeseen expenses.
  4. Guarantee: Ask about guarantees for both the installation work and the item.

The Installation Process

The installation process can vary depending upon the type of cat flap, but generally consists of the following steps:

  1. Selecting Location: Choose where you desire the cat flap to be installed, preferably in a low-traffic location.
  2. Measuring: Accurately determine the wall or door to make sure the flap fits properly.
  3. Cutting the Opening: The installer will cut an opening that matches the size of the cat flap.
  4. Fitting the Flap: The cat flap is put into the opening, guaranteeing it is level and secure.
  5. Evaluating: After installation, the installer will check the flap to make certain it runs efficiently.

Test Installation Cost Table

Costs can differ substantially depending upon various elements, including area, installer rates, and the kind of cat flap. Here's a sample table to provide a basic sense of what you might anticipate to pay:

Type of Flap

Product Costs

Installation Costs

Overall Estimated Cost

Manual Cat Flap

₤ 30 - ₤ 100

₤ 50 - ₤ 100

₤ 80 - ₤ 200

Electronic Cat Flap

₤ 100 - ₤ 300

₤ 75 - ₤ 150

₤ 175 - ₤ 450

Safe Cat Flap

₤ 75 - ₤ 200

₤ 100 - ₤ 200

₤ 175 - ₤ 400

Wide Range Cat Flap

₤ 150 - ₤ 400

₤ 100 - ₤ 250

₤ 250 - ₤ 650

Upkeep Tips for Cat Flaps

Once the cat flap is installed, upkeep is essential to guaranteeing its durability and functionality. Here are some essential ideas: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Dust and debris can accumulate, so tidy the flap regularly.
  2. Inspect Seals: Ensure the seals stay intact to prevent drafts and unwanted entry.
  3. Battery Replacement: For electronic flaps, schedule routine battery checks and replacements.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can any cat utilize a cat flap?

Many cats can learn to use a cat flap, but it's important to introduce the flap slowly to ensure they are comfy.

2. How long does click here require to set up a cat flap?

Normally, the installation can take anywhere from 1 to 3 hours, depending on the complexity.

3. Are cat flaps secure?

Lots of modern cat flaps feature security features, such as locking mechanisms and microchip recognition, which can deter intruders.

4. Can a cat flap be installed in any door?

Yes, but some products (like metal or thick wood) might require extra tools or specialized installation.

5. How can I train my cat to utilize the flap?

Start by propping the flap open and motivating your cat with deals with to enter and exit until they're comfy using it separately.
